Synopsis
The true tale of madness, genius, and obsession about two remarkable men who created literary history with the writing of the Oxford English Dictionary. The compilation of the Oxford English Dictionary began in 1857 by professor James Murray, who took on the challenge of creating the most comprehensive dictionary ever compiled. By “crowd sourcing” the work; that is, by enlisting definitions from people all over the world, the dictionary could be compiled in mere decades instead of a century. As definitions were collected, the overseeing committee, led by Professor Murray, discovered that one man, Dr. W. C. Minor, had submitted more than ten thousand. When the committee insisted on honoring him, a shocking truth came to light: Dr. Minor, an American Civil War veteran, was a convicted murderer and being held at an asylum for the criminally insane.
